5. Form register.php
?php session_start;
db = mysqli_connectlocalhost, root, , db_elearning; ?
DOCTYPE html html
head meta charset=utf-8
meta name=viewport content=width=device-width, initial-scale=1, maximum-scale=1
titleDaftar E-Learning Sopo Heliostitle link href=styleassetscssbootstrap.css rel=stylesheet
link href=styleassetscssfont-awesome.css rel=stylesheet link href=styleassetscssstyle.css rel=stylesheet
head body
header div class=container
div class=row div class=col-md-12
Anda sudah punya akun ? Silahkan a href=. class=btn btn-xs btn-dangerLogina
div div
div header
-- HEADER END-- div class=navbar navbar-inverse set-radius-zero
div class=container div class=navbar-header
button type=button class=navbar-toggle data-toggle=collapse data-target=.navbar-collapse
span class=icon-barspan span class=icon-barspan
span class=icon-barspan button
a class=navbar-brand href=. img src=styleassetsimglogosopo.png width=200
a div
div class=left-div div class=user-settings-wrapper
ul class=nav li class=dropdown
a class=dropdown-toggle span class=glyphicon glyphicon-user style=font-size:
25px;span a
Universitas Sumatera Utara
li ul
div div
div div
section class=menu-section div class=container
div class=row div class=col-md-12
div class=navbar-collapse collapse ul id=menu-top class=nav navbar-nav navbar-right
lia ?php if_GET[page] == { echo class=menu-top- active; } ? href=?hal=daftarRegisterali
lia ?php if_GET[page] == berita { echo class=menu-top- active; } ? href=?hal=daftarpage=beritaBeritaali
ul div
div div
div section
div class=content-wrapper div class=container
?php if_GET[page] == { ?
div class=row div class=col-md-12
h4 class=page-head-linePendaftaran akun e-learningh4 div
div div class=row
div class=col-md-6 h4iSilahkan isi data Anda dengan benar ih4
form method=post enctype=multipartform-data NIS :input type=text name=nis
class=form-control required Nama Lengkap : input type=text
name=nama_lengkap class=form-control required Tempat Lahir : input type=text
name=tempat_lahir class=form-control required Tanggal Lahir : input type=date
name=tgl_lahir class=form-control required Jenis Kelamin :
select name=jenis_kelamin class=form-control required option value=- Pilih -option
option value=LLaki-lakioption option value=PPerempuanoption
select Agama :
Universitas Sumatera Utara
select name=agama class=form-control required option value=- Pilih -option
option value=IslamIslamoption option value=KristenKristenoption
option value=KatholikKatholikoption option value=HinduHinduoption
option value=BudhaBudhaoption option value=KonghucuKonghucuoption
select Nama Ayah : input type=text
name=nama_ayah class=form-control required Nama Ibu : input type=text
name=nama_ibu class=form-control required Nomor Telepon : input type=text
name=no_telp class=form-control Email : input type=email name=email
class=form-control Alamat : textarea name=alamat
class=form-control rows=3 requiredtextarea Kelas :
select name=kelas class=form-control required option value=- Pilih -option
?php sql_kelas = mysqli_querydb,
SELECT from tb_kelas or die db-error; whiledata_kelas = mysqli_fetch_arraysql_kelas {
echo option value=.data_kelas[id_kelas]..data_kelas[nama_kelas].op
tion; } ?
select Tahun Masuk :
select name=thn_masuk class=form-control required option value=- Pilih -option
?php for i = 2020; i = 2000; i-- {
echo option value=.i..i.option; } ?
select Foto : input type=file name=gambar
class=form-control Username : input type=text
name=user class=form-control required Password : input type=password
name=pass class=form-control required br
ibCatatanb : Tanda wajib disii hr
input type=submit name=daftar value=Daftar class=btn btn- info
input type=reset class=btn btn-danger form
Universitas Sumatera Utara
?php if_POST[daftar] {
nis = mysqli_real_escape_stringdb, _POST[nis];
nama_lengkap = mysqli_real_escape_stringdb, _POST[nama_lengkap];
tempat_lahir = mysqli_real_escape_stringdb, _POST[tempat_lahir];
tgl_lahir = mysqli_real_escape_stringdb, _POST[tgl_lahir];
jenis_kelamin = mysqli_real_escape_stringdb, _POST[jenis_kelamin];
agama = mysqli_real_escape_stringdb, _POST[agama];
nama_ayah = mysqli_real_escape_stringdb, _POST[nama_ayah];
nama_ibu = mysqli_real_escape_stringdb, _POST[nama_ibu];
no_telp = mysqli_real_escape_stringdb, _POST[no_telp];
email = mysqli_real_escape_stringdb, _POST[email];
alamat = mysqli_real_escape_stringdb, _POST[alamat];
kelas = mysqli_real_escape_stringdb, _POST[kelas];
thn_masuk = mysqli_real_escape_stringdb, _POST[thn_masuk];
user = mysqli_real_escape_stringdb, _POST[user];
pass = mysqli_real_escape_stringdb, _POST[pass];
sumber = _FILES[gambar][tmp_name]; target = imgfoto_siswa;
nama_gambar = _FILES[gambar][name];
sql_cek_user = mysqli_querydb, SELECT FROM tb_siswa WHERE username = user or die db-error;
ifmysqli_num_rowssql_cek_user 0 { echo scriptalertUsername yang Anda pilih sudah ada, silahkan
ganti yang lain;script; } else {
ifnama_gambar = { ifmove_uploaded_filesumber, target.nama_gambar {
mysqli_querydb, INSERT INTO tb_siswa VALUES, nis, nama_lengkap, tempat_lahir,
tgl_lahir, jenis_kelamin, agama, nama_ayah, nama_ibu, no_telp, email, alamat, kelas, thn_masuk,
nama_gambar, user, md5pass, pass, tidak aktif or die db-error;
Universitas Sumatera Utara
echo scriptalertPendaftaran berhasil, silahkan login; window.location=.script;
} else { echo scriptalertGagal mendaftar, foto gagal diupload, coba
lagi;script; }
} else { mysqli_querydb, INSERT INTO
tb_siswa VALUES, nis, nama_lengkap, tempat_lahir, tgl_lahir, jenis_kelamin, agama, nama_ayah, nama_ibu,
no_telp, email, alamat, kelas, thn_masuk, anonim.png, user, md5pass, pass, tidak aktif or die
db-error; echo scriptalertPendaftaran berhasil, tunggu akun aktif dan
silahkan login; window.location=.script; }
} }
? div
div class=col-md-6 div class=alert alert-warning
Untuk menggunakan layanan e-learning ini Anda harus memiliki akun terlebih dahulu.
div div
div ?php
} else if_GET[page] == berita { include incberita.php;
} ? div
div footer
div class=container div class=row
div class=col-md-12 copy; 2015 E-Learing Sopo Helios | By : Daniel Agus Sidabutar
div div
div footer
script src=styleassetsjsjquery-1.11.1.jsscript script src=styleassetsjsbootstrap.jsscript
body html
6. Form +koneksi.php